I will be traveling to the Skipton area for Yarndale. All of the bed and breakfasts in Skipton appear to be booked, so I'm looking into alternative areas. Does anyone have suggestions for towns/villages with convenient access to Skipton (or suggestions for nearby B and B's!)? Preferably would like something on the cuter side with at least one pub/restaurant for dinner. I'll be renting a car so can also doing something more rural.

If you stay in Malham, you'll pass Town End Farm Shop on the road back from Skipton. Fabulous tea room, not open in the evenings unfortunately, but worth stopping for lunch. The Yorkshire chorizo and mozzarella wrap was so good I went back the next day for seconds.
